Hardware boosts communication speed by six times in Multicore chips

Computer engineers at North Carolina State University have developed hardware that allows programs to operate more efficiently by boosting the speed at which the “cores” on a computer chip communicate with each other by six times. Stem Cell RNA Interference Treatment for HIV is Closer

Ad Support : Nano Technology   Netbook    Technology News &nbsp  Computer Software A novel stem cell therapy that arms the immune system with an intrinsic defence against HIV could be a powerful strategy to tackle the disease.
